CTKB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

158 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cytek Biosciences (CTKB)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$270M — down 13% from $311M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 27 funds closed out of CTKB and 25 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 47 trimmed existing stakes and 65 added.

The largest buyer was Topline Capital Management, adding an estimated $12.5M. The largest seller was Vanguard Group, cutting an estimated $6.19M.
